This is a notice of intent to award a sole source contract to Biosense Webster, Inc. for preventive maintenance and warranty services on Carto 3S and Smartablates at the Minneapolis VA Health Care System. The authority for this sole source award is FAR ****(a). Interested parties must submit a capabilities statement by April 23rd, 2026, at 17:00 CT, providing clear evidence of their capability to provide the required services. Verbal responses and phone calls will not be accepted. If no viable responses are received by the deadline, the Department of Veterans Affairs will negotiate solely with Biosense Webster, Inc. This notice is not a request for quotations, and no solicitation will be available for competitive quotes.

This is a notice of intent to negotiate a sole source contract with Biosense Webster for an Accelerated Solutions Agreement (ASA) for maintenance of CART03, TRUPULSE, and NGEN generator equipment and software. Biosense Webster is the only authorized vendor for maintenance on these machines. The contract will be firm fixed price for a one-year base period with two one-year options. The NAICS code is **** with a business size standard of $34. 0 million. No solicitation documents are available. Any firm believing it can meet these requirements must provide written notification to the contracting officer by 10:00 AM local time Central on Friday, April 10, 2026. Supporting evidence, including a letter from the OEM stating the vendor is an authorized service vendor, must be submitted to joni. dorr@va. gov.
